Description

The counterpart to the 2007 Menghai “Wei Zong Wei”, this bing is composed of leaves from Old Growth trees from Yiwu mountain. It is a careful blend of 2006 Autumn leaves and 2007 Spring leaves from a single area, producing a well rounded tea with a feeling of quality to the brew.

As ever with the 12 Gentlemen productions there has been meticulous attention to detail at every stage producing a very high quality young puerh which is designed with slow and graceful ageing in mind.

This is also an excellent ‘drink-now’ puerh, with a caramel like soup, long lasting huigan (sweet aftertaste) coating the mouth and throat, and a full, rounded flavour.

This bing is tightly pressed, and use of a tuocha pick is highly recommended to separate this for brewing. If you need one, let me know & I’ll give you one with your bing.
